CALGARY — Three people are facing multiple charges after more than 200 weapons were seized from a northeast Calgary home.

Police say modified shotguns, replica firearms, swords, throwing knives and a crossbow were among the weapons taken from the house last week.

Officers found the weapons during an investigation into stolen property.

Stolen items, cash and drugs were also uncovered at the house.

Police believe the location was being used as a "fence house" where stolen goods were being traded for marijuana and cocaine.

Tanner Ray Lang, who is 32Jan-Anne Marie August, who is 24and 41-year-old Mark Lee Gardner face property, drugs and weapons-related charges.
